- Betterment insurance refers to:
- Supplemental coverage for improvements made by a lessee to a leased space1.
- The betterment clause in auto insurance, which states that the insurer will not pay for repairs or replacements that would improve the value or quality of the car after an accident2.
- Actions or expenses that add value or improve performance, often covered by renters purchasing betterment insurance3.
